L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A: Henry Cavill has been facing a string of bad luck. After he announced his exit from the role of 'Geralt of Rivia', he still had his 'Superman' gig lined up — that is of course until 'Synderverse' was scrapped entirely with DC opting to go with James Gunn's vision with new actors. However, as Season 3 of 'The Witcher' is nearing its release date, showrunner Lauren Hissrich has teased something for ensuring a good farewell for Cavill. 

'The Witcher' Season 3 will be Cavill's last time as Geralt. While he has been welcoming of Liam Hemsworth as his replacement in Season 4, fans were not happy with the re-casting. For long-time fans of 'The Witcher', Cavill perfectly embodied the spirit of Geralt and wanted to continue seeing him in the role for as long as possible. 

What is the 'heroic send-off'? 

While not much has been revealed about how 'The Witcher' Season 3 will end but its creator Hissrich has assured that Cavill will have a 'heroic' send-off from the series as the show will start preparing for Liam Hemsworth's take on the lead role in Season 4. Deadline reported Hissrich saying that, "Geralt’s big turn is about giving up neutrality and doing anything that he has to do to get to Ciri [Freya Allan]. And to me, it’s the most heroic sendoff that we could have, even though it wasn’t written to be that".

Geralt will give up on his neutrality 

Geralt giving up on his neutrality shows his willingness to protect Ciri from everything, which may lead to Geralt being more proactive in Season 3. Even Cavill mentioned at the Netflix Tudum event that the stakes are a lot higher for Geralt at this point, because he is finally realising the importance of loved ones. Season 3 of the hit Netflix series will witness Geralt acknowledging his feelings and revealing his more paternal side towards Ciri. 

While Season 3 would finally address the build-up that took place in the previous two seasons, it would also be preparing Geralt to take up a new mission in Season 4. Hissrich further said, "Geralt has a new mission in mind when we come back to him in Season 4. He’s a slightly different Geralt than we expected. Now, by the way, that’s an understatement”.



 

'The Witcher' Season 3 Volume 1 will start streaming from June 29, 2023 on Netflix.
